Conduction disorders after aortic valve replacement with rapid-deployment bioprostheses: early occurrence and
Augusto D'Onofrio1, Chiara Tessari1, Lorenzo Bagozzi1
1Department of Cardiac, Thoracic, Vascular Sciences and Public Health, University of Padova, Padova, Italy.
Nearly 40% of patients experience conduction disorders (CDs) after rapid-deployment aortic valve implantation. Bioprosthesis size and patient age are key risk factors for these CDs, with some patients recovering function within a year.

Background:
- Rapid-deployment bioprostheses are advanced aortic valve substitutes.
- Conduction disorders (CDs) and permanent pacemaker implantation (PPI) are potential complications.
- Evaluating CDs after these implants is crucial for patient outcomes.
Purpose of the Study:
- To assess the incidence of CDs post-rapid-deployment aortic valve implantation.
- To identify risk factors for CDs and PPI at discharge and 1-year follow-up.
- To determine the recovery rate of CDs within one year.
Main Methods:
- Retrospective single-center study of 98 patients undergoing aortic valve replacement (AVR) with rapid-deployment bioprostheses.
- Electrocardiograms (ECGs) recorded pre-procedure, post-ICU, daily, and at 1-year follow-up.
- Analysis of CDs and PPI incidence, with risk factor identification.
Main Results:
- At discharge, 40.8% of patients had CDs, with 33.7% experiencing new CDs and 7.1% requiring PPI.
- Valve size was the sole independent predictor of CDs at discharge.
- At 1-year, 31.3% had CDs or pacemaker-induced rhythm; age and prosthesis size predicted these outcomes.
Conclusions:
- Approximately 40% of patients develop new CDs after rapid-deployment aortic valve implantation.
- One-third of these patients show recovery of conduction by 1-year follow-up.
- Bioprosthesis size and patient age are significant independent risk factors for CDs.
